Job Summary: The Dual Language Spanish and English Classroom Teacher fosters bilingualism, biliteracy, and multicultural competence, inspiring students to achieve and thrive.
Education and Experience: Bachelor's in Elementary or Bilingual Education, proficiency in Spanish and English, experience in dual language or bilingual classrooms, and student teaching background.
Licenses and Certifications: Valid Illinois Professional Educator License or equivalent, with Bilingual Education and/or ESL endorsements.
Skills and Abilities: Knowledge of dual language principles, curriculum standards, assessment practices, language acquisition, and effective teaching strategies.
Essential Functions: Include instructional planning, classroom environment management, assessment, collaboration, and advocacy activities.
